Are you an Electrical Engineer looking to move into a Sales Engineer role, or an early-career Sales Engineer wanting to deepen your technical expertise? Hartland Recruitment is working with a manufacturer of switchgear and electrical power engineering components, seeking a Sales Engineer to develop as part of their growth in the UK. This is a great opportunity to build a long-term career combining engineering knowledge with customer-facing work.
The Role
- Technical sales of switchgear and power engineering solutions
- Understanding customer requirements and producing technical quotations
- Supporting contractors, consultants, and end users
- Working closely with engineering and manufacturing teams
About You
- Electrical engineering background (degree, HND or HNC, NVQ, apprenticeship or equivalent)
- Interest in power distribution / switchgear / LV & MV systems
- Confident communicator with a commercial mindset
- Sales experience helpful but not essential; training provided
What We Offer
- Salary of £40,000
- Structured development and mentoring
- Manufacturer environment with real engineering involvement
- Clear progression into a senior technical-commercial role
